Chemical Process Engineer targeting complex small molecules, peptides, and highly actives for active pharmaceutical ingredients. Performs research and development activities for the purpose of designing/improving a process or technology. And provides process engineering support for manufacturing processes in assigned group, or plant, through proactive problem prevention and troubleshooting, as well as identifying and implementing process improvements. Provides leadership and project management to work groups on large scale projects and technology transfers.
ESSENTIALDUTIESANDRESPONSIBILITIES
Include the following. Other duties may be assigned.
- Knowledge of plant scale unit operations, scale-up, and plant design considerations, especially as they apply to the production of APIs
- Broad understanding of chemical reactivity, potential exotherms, cross-reactivity, side products, and waste streams
- Evaluating new process fits into manufacturing, having good understanding of process fit issues – safety factors, standard cost, equipment, chemistry, and unit operations
- Performing process development at the lab scale, concentrating on key scale-up parameters to scale up from kilo-scale to full production scale
- Supporting manufacturing through authoring operating procedures, SOPs, guidelines, PSI packages, developing process models, and assembling technology transfer packages
- Participating in or leading technology transfer from one manufacturing site to another; developing and implementing innovative process scale-up technologies.
- Performing process validation on an API process.
- Knowledge and application of QEH&S regulatory compliance principles related to chemical and pharmaceutical manufacturing, including FDA, cGMPs, EPA, OSHA, and PSM requirements
- Position may require day-to-day support to manufacturing and process development, at times requiring attention outside of the normal work hours. Support includes troubleshooting and continuous improvement of equipment and processes, as well as participation in change control, deviations, and investigations
- Identifying, evaluating, developing, and implementing process improvements and optimization that reduce costs; improve yield, cycle times and product quality; resolve or prevent environmental, health and safety impacts; reduce down time; improve process consistency; and improve process robustness
- Developing and implementing detailed plans for projects, including successful technology transfers, and implementing processes into pilot and commercial-scale facilities, providing leadership and technical project management
